1-2-1 Digital BETACAM Format

Tape format

The DVW-522/522P adopts the newly developed Digital BETACAM
format as an extension of the BETACAM/BETACAM SP format. The
Digital BETACAM format makes the best of the available recording area
to achieve high-quality digital recording while keeping analog BETACAM
tape playback compatibility. The following are developed for this purpose:
• Coefficient recording system
• Powerful error correction system
• High-quality precision heads and drum with dynamic tracking (DT) heads
• New automatic tracking system
These enable 120 minutes or more of playback time with Digital
BETACAM (when using L-size cassettes), while the cassette size of the
Digital BETACAM is exactly same as the normal BETACAM and
BETACAM SP.
Note
The DVW-522/522P is designed exclusively for playing back digitally
recorded video cassette tapes.
The video and four-channel audio signals of each field are recorded onto
the tape with six helical tracks, using a slightly slower tape speed and three
times faster drum rotation speed than the conventional BETACAM and
BETACAM SP formats.
The Digital BETACAM format has three longitudinal tracks: a CTL track,
a time code (LTC) track and a cue audio track, identical to the
conventional BETACAM and BETACAM SP format.
However, the conventional audio channel-1 track is deleted and used for
expansion of the helical tracks. The larger drum diameter enables optimum
digital recording, while analog BETACAM playback compatibility is
maintained by specially developed time base corrector circuits.
